لیست مطالب
استفاده از سرور اختصاصی، گامی بزرگ و حیاتی برای کسب و کارهایی است که به دنبال عملکرد، امنیت و کنترل کامل بر منابع میزبانی خود هستند. این راهکار قدرتمند به شما اجازه میدهد تا بدون اشتراک گذاری منابع با دیگران، وب سایتها، اپلیکیشنها یا سرویسهای خود را با بالاترین کیفیت ممکن اجرا کنید. با این حال، یکی از چالشهای متداول در مدیریت سرور اختصاصی، کنترل مصرف ترافیک و پهنای باند است. هزینههای ناشی از ترافیک اضافه میتواند به سرعت از کنترل خارج شده و به یک هزینه غیرمنتظره و سنگین در پایان ماه تبدیل شود.
بسیاری از مدیران سرور تنها زمانی متوجه اهمیت مدیریت ترافیک میشوند که با صورتحسابهای بالا روبرو میشوند. این هزینهها نه تنها بودجه شما را تحت فشار قرار میدهند، بلکه میتوانند نشانهای از مشکلات عمیقتری مانند حملات امنیتی، پیکربندی نادرست سرور یا بهینه نبودن محتوای وب سایت باشند. خبر خوب این است که با اتخاذ رویکردهای هوشمندانه و پیشگیرانه، میتوانید مصرف ترافیک سرور خود را به طور چشمگیری بهینه کنید، از هزینههای ناخواسته جلوگیری کرده و در عین حال، عملکرد سرویسهای خود را نیز بهبود بخشید. در این مقاله جامع، پنج نکته کلیدی و کاربردی را بررسی خواهیم کرد که به شما کمک میکنند تا کنترل کاملی بر مصرف ترافیک سرور اختصاصی خود داشته باشید و با خیال راحت بر رشد کسب و کار خود تمرکز کنید.
۱. نظارت، تحلیل و پایش مداوم ترافیک سرور
اولین و بنیادیترین قدم برای مدیریت هر منبعی، اندازهگیری و نظارت بر آن است. شما نمیتوانید چیزی را که نمیبینید، بهینه کنید. نظارت دقیق بر ترافیک ورودی و خروجی سرور اختصاصی، دیدی شفاف از الگوهای مصرف به شما میدهد و به شناسایی سریع ناهنجاریها کمک میکند. بدون پایش مداوم، ممکن است فعالیتهای غیرعادی مانند حملات DDoS در مقیاس کوچک، فعالیت رباتهای مخرب یا لینکدهی مستقیم به فایلهای شما (Hotlinking) برای مدتها پنهان بمانند و پهنای باند ارزشمند شما را مصرف کنند.

برای این کار، ابزارهای متعددی در دسترس است. در سطح سیستمعامل، ابزارهای خط فرمان مانند nload، iftop و iptraf-ng در لینوکس میتوانند ترافیک شبکه را به صورت زنده نمایش دهند. برای تحلیلهای جامعتر و بلندمدت، میتوانید از نرمافزارهای مانیتورینگ پیشرفتهتری مانند Zabbix، Nagios یا PRTG Network Monitor استفاده کنید. این ابزارها به شما اجازه میدهند تا گزارشهای دقیقی از منابع مصرفکننده ترافیک، آدرسهای IP مبدا و مقصد، پروتکلهای مورد استفاده و ساعات اوج مصرف تهیه کنید.
با تحلیل این دادهها، میتوانید به سوالات مهمی پاسخ دهید: کدام بخش از وب سایت شما بیشترین ترافیک را مصرف میکند؟ آیا ترافیک از مناطق جغرافیایی غیرمنتظرهای میآید؟ آیا افزایش ناگهانی ترافیک در ساعات خاصی از شبانهروز طبیعی است یا مشکوک؟ پاسخ به این سوالات، سنگ بنای استراتژی بهینهسازی شما خواهد بود.
۲. بهره گیری از شبکه توزیع محتوا (CDN)
یکی از موثرترین روشها برای کاهش بار ترافیکی سرور اصلی، استفاده از شبکه توزیع محتوا (Content Delivery Network یا CDN) است. یک CDN شبکهای از سرورهای پراکنده در نقاط مختلف جغرافیایی است که یک نسخه از فایلهای استاتیک وب سایت شما (مانند تصاویر، ویدئوها، فایلهای CSS و جاوا اسکریپت) را در خود ذخیره (کش) میکند.
هنگامی که کاربری قصد بازدید از وب سایت شما را دارد، CDN به طور هوشمند محتوا را از نزدیکترین سرور به موقعیت جغرافیایی آن کاربر ارائه میدهد. این فرآیند دو مزیت بزرگ به همراه دارد: اول اینکه سرعت بارگذاری سایت برای کاربر به شکل قابل توجهی افزایش مییابد، زیرا دادهها مسافت کمتری را طی میکنند. دوم و مهمتر از نظر مدیریت ترافیک، بخش بزرگی از درخواستها دیگر به سرور اختصاصی اصلی شما نمیرسند. این یعنی بخش قابل توجهی از پهنای باند شما آزاد میشود و سرور اصلی تنها وظیفه پردازش محتوای داینامیک و منطق اصلی اپلیکیشن را بر عهده خواهد داشت. استفاده از CDN نه تنها مصرف ترافیک شما را به شدت کاهش میدهد، بلکه با توزیع بار، مقاومت وب سایت شما را در برابر ترافیکهای سنگین و حتی برخی حملات DDoS افزایش میدهد.
۳. بهینه سازی حداکثری محتوای وب سایت

حجم هر بایت دادهای که از سرور شما به مرورگر کاربر ارسال میشود، در مصرف کل ترافیک شما محاسبه میگردد. بنابراین، کاهش حجم صفحات وب سایت یکی از روشهای مستقیم و کارآمد برای صرفهجویی در پهنای باند است. بهینهسازی محتوا شامل چندین تکنیک کلیدی است:
- فشردهسازی تصاویر: تصاویر معمولا حجیمترین بخش یک صفحه وب را تشکیل میدهند. استفاده از فرمتهای مدرن مانند WebP، فشردهسازی تصاویر بدون افت کیفیت محسوس و استفاده از تکنیک Lazy Loading (بارگذاری تصاویر تنها زمانی که کاربر به آنها اسکرول میکند) میتواند حجم صفحات را به طرز چشمگیری کاهش دهد.
- فشرده سازی Gzip/Brotli: این تکنولوژیها به سرور شما اجازه میدهند تا فایلهای متنی (HTML، CSS، JavaScript) را قبل از ارسال، فشرده کرده و نسخه کمحجمتری را به مرورگر کاربر ارسال کند. مرورگر به طور خودکار این فایلها را از حالت فشرده خارج میکند. فعالسازی این قابلیت بر روی وب سرور (مانند Apache یا Nginx) یک اقدام ضروری و بسیار موثر است.
- کوچک سازی (Minification) کدها: فرآیند کوچک سازی، تمام کاراکترهای غیرضروری مانند فاصلهها، کامنتها و خطوط جدید را از فایلهای HTML، CSS و JavaScript حذف میکند. این کار بدون تغییر در عملکرد کد، حجم فایلها را کاهش داده و به کاهش مصرف ترافیک کمک میکند.
۴. جلوگیری از Hotlinking و مدیریت دسترسی ربات ها
Hotlinking یا "دزدی پهنای باند" زمانی اتفاق میافتد که وب سایتهای دیگر، تصاویر یا فایلهای رسانهای شما را با قرار دادن لینک مستقیم فایل در وب سایت خودشان نمایش میدهند. در این حالت، هر بار که آن وب سایت بازدید میشود، فایل مستقیما از سرور شما بارگذاری شده و پهنای باند شما مصرف میشود، در حالی که هیچ سودی برای شما ندارد. خوشبختانه جلوگیری از این کار بسیار ساده است. با افزودن چند خط کد به فایل .htaccess در سرورهای Apache یا تنظیمات مشابه در Nginx، میتوانید به سرور خود دستور دهید که اجازه بارگذاری فایلها را به دامنههای دیگر ندهد.
علاوه بر این، مدیریت رباتها و خزندههای وب نیز اهمیت دارد. در حالی که خزندههای موتورهای جستجوی معتبر مانند گوگل برای سئو ضروری هستند، رباتهای مخرب، اسکرپرها و خزندههای بیکیفیت میتوانند با ارسال درخواستهای مکرر، پهنای باند زیادی را هدر دهند. با استفاده از یک فایل robots.txt بهینه و همچنین ابزارهای امنیتی و فایروالها، میتوانید دسترسی این رباتهای ناخواسته را مسدود یا محدود کنید.
۵. انتخاب هوشمندانه پلن و مشاوره با ارائه دهنده خدمات

پیشگیری همیشه بهتر از درمان است. انتخاب یک پلن سرور اختصاصی که از ابتدا با نیازهای ترافیکی شما همخوانی داشته باشد، میتواند از بروز بسیاری از مشکلات جلوگیری کند. قبل از انتخاب پلن، ترافیک فعلی و پیشبینی رشد آینده خود را با دقت ارزیابی کنید.
مهمتر از آن، سیاستهای ارائهدهنده خدمات خود را در مورد ترافیک اضافه به دقت مطالعه کنید. هزینه هر گیگابایت یا ترابایت ترافیک اضافه چقدر است؟ آیا امکان ارتقای پلن در میانه دوره قرارداد وجود دارد؟ آیا هشداری قبل از عبور از آستانه ترافیک برای شما ارسال میشود؟
یک ارائهدهنده خدمات معتبر مانند صفرویک، تنها یک فروشنده نیست، بلکه یک شریک فنی برای کسبوکار شماست. از دانش و تجربه کارشناسان آنها استفاده کنید. با تیم پشتیبانی فنی مشورت کنید و نیازهای خود را به طور شفاف توضیح دهید. آنها میتوانند بر اساس تجربه خود، بهترین پلن را به شما پیشنهاد دهند و راهکارهای سفارشی برای مدیریت و بهینهسازی مصرف ترافیک در اختیار شما قرار دهند تا با آرامش خاطر، بر توسعه کسب و کار خود متمرکز شوید.
صفرویک پرداز
مدیریت ترافیک سرور اختصاصی نباید یک چالش پیچیده باشد. در صفرویک پرداز، ما با ارائه زیرساخت قدرتمند، ابزارهای نظارتی پیشرفته و پشتیبانی تخصصی، به شما کمک می کنیم تا کنترل کاملی بر منابع خود داشته باشید. برای دریافت مشاوره در زمینه انتخاب و بهینه سازی سرور اختصاصی متناسب با نیازهایتان و جلوگیری از هزینههای غیرمنتظره، همین امروز با کارشناسان ما تماس بگیرید.